A Whale that Shorted ETH 20x has DCA'd $17.04M over the past 6 days to avoid liquidation
BlockBeats News, July 18th, according to Onchain Lens monitoring, a whale has been continuously depositing funds into HyperLiquid to avoid liquidation of its ETH (20x) short position, which is currently worth 56.76 million US dollars.
Over the past 6 days, the whale has deposited 17.04 million USDC, with a unrealized loss of 10 million US dollars.
